Les Cretes Petite Arvine Fleur 2022

Colour

Bright, straw yellow.

Bouquet

Floral, with fragrant notes of jasmine, peony, apple, plum and citrus fruits.

Flavour

Tasty and fresh vein. Balanced on the palate, with marine undertones and lively minerality.

Pairing

It pairs well with fish, shellfish, and white meats. It also pairs with carpaccio, cured meats, and cheeses.

History The vine is so-called because of its small berries. The Aosta Valley has always disputed its paternity with neighbouring Switzerland.
Origin Aymavilles.
Climate Altitude: 550 - 750 m. a.s.l. Exposure: West-South.
Soil composition Morainic, loose, sandy on slopes.
Cultivation system Guyot.
No. plants per hectare 7,500 vines per hectare.
Yield per hectare 10,000 kg/hectare.
Harvest By hand, at the end of September.
Fermentation temperature 18 °C (64 °F)
Fermentation period 12 days.
Vinification Gentle pressing, 12 days of fermentation in stainless steel tanks at a controlled temperature of 18°C.
Ageing 1-2 months on the lees with constant batônnage.
